Anyone have any ideas on why my front passenger side power window won't roll down ?

I've changed the switch and swapped motors with the back and still it didn't work. I even had the window down manually and it went up just fine:ybrick:

I recently Installed some speakers in the doors and thats when it stopped working. Maybe I did something when I put them in or could it be the master switch ?

Welcome to the forum. Hang out browse around a little. There is a relay called the door/power window control, or something like that, that may be your culprit. I think it is under your dash near the steering column. I don't have the same year as you, so I am not positive where it is. However, if they were working before you put the speakers in take a look at everything you touched during that process. It is likely that the two are connected. Is the motor clicking? No chance that the magnet is in the way of the track or anything is there?
